Projected Cost SavingsRedesigned Packaging and Layout for Carts

Before Improvements:

25 units/hour with a crew size of 7 people

EAU = 7,136 units/year – 2,000 labor hours

After Improvements:

28 units/hour with a crew size of 6 people

EAU = 7,136 units/year – 1,529 labor hours

Total Labor Hours Saved = 471 hours

Labor Rate = $42.14/hour

Estimated Total Annual Savings = $ 19,8504

Projected Cost SavingsRedesigned Packaging for Video Walls

Per Unit Per Year

(EAU=24K)

Materials Savings = $1.55 $37,200

Labor Savings = $2.95 $70,800

Total Savings = $4.50 $108,000

Projected Annual Savings = $108,0007

Projects In ProcessDedicated Cells to Utilize Optimal Crew Sizes

Features:

Shop Orders routed to specific cells based on Crew Size

Cells are located across the aisle from staging areas

Next Shop Order is setup prior to completion of current order

Benefits

Increases productivity since work load is balanced

Scheduler schedules multiple orders

Cell leader knows in advance the next orders to run

Minimizes or eliminates downtime between orders

Projects In ProcessWork Cell Floor and Table Layout Template

Features:

Shows Material Handlers where to place containers of parts

Shows Cell Leaders and Workers:

what parts are required for each work station

where to place parts at the work stations

Benefits

Allows Material Handlers to perform part of the setup

Locates parts close to point-of-use

Minimizes travel distances between containers and stations

Minimizes or eliminates downtime between orders
